Vacancy

Senior Back-end developer

Job description

Our partner, international IT company established in 2017 and headquartered in Nicosia, Cyprus is looking for a Senior Back-end developer

Requirements

  • At least 5 years of experience in software engineering (PHP, Python, JavaScript)
  • Experience with Yii2 (other frameworks will be an advantage)
  • Experience with MySQL, Redis, Elasticsearch
  • Experience with large applications development and support
  • Experience with service and microservice architecture
  • Proficient knowledge of full development cycle
  • Proficient knowledge of Linux, Bash, Docker
  • Good understanding of Key-value store, Memcached
  • Good understanding of CI/CD practices

Responsibilities

  • Developing the back-end part of our product using PHP 7.2+/Yii2
  • Provide review, audit, and optimization of current architecture
  • Optimization of the application for maximum performance, scalability and high availability
  • Code review, refactoring and requirement analysis
  • Building reusable code and libraries for future use
  • Design and implementation of data storage solutions
  • Implementation of security and data protection
  • Writing tests for functional and unit testing

We offer

  • Remote/office
  • Flexible work schedule
  • Competitive salary
  • Paid sick leave and vacations
  • Medical insurance
  • English courses
  • Friendly atmosphere
  • Corporate events
  • Cozy office in the city center

join our team

Leave your info - we will contact you!

Contact Information